The Edmonton Oilers and Florida Panthers are set to face off in the Stanley Cup Final for the second consecutive year.
Edmonton clinched their spot in the championship round on Thursday, defeating the Dallas Stars 5-3 in Game 5 of the Western Conference Final.
Captain Connor McDavid scored the game-winning goal, Edmonton`s fourth, in the second period. His team effectively countered every push from Dallas throughout the game.
This victory marks the second year in a row the Oilers have eliminated the Stars in the Western Conference Final, following their six-game series win in 2024.
Edmonton will host Game 1 of the Stanley Cup Final against the defending champions, the Florida Panthers, on Wednesday, June 5. Fans will recall that last season, the Oilers, as Western Conference champions, staged a near-miraculous comeback from a 3-0 deficit in the Final before ultimately losing in Game 7.
